Output 8872fc9fb81a08c760d151423e835aa7f3a128e90a868dfdd22312f161ac8f8f:0

value
12728567
script pubkey
OP_0 OP_PUSHBYTES_20 4cddc4fea5948ebc95226eebaefa5313281bd5e8
address
bc1qfnwufl49jj8te9fzdm46a7jnzv5ph40g68q33s
transaction
8872fc9fb81a08c760d151423e835aa7f3a128e90a868dfdd22312f161ac8f8f
spent
true